Hotels in Bahrain

Search Bahrain Hotels

Enter your dates for the latest hotel rates and availability.

Hot travel dates
Today
Tomorrow
This Weekend
Next Weekend
April 2025
  • Mon
  • Tue
  • Wed
  • Thu
  • Fri
  • Sat
  • Sun
  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 7
  • 8
  • 9
  • 10
  • 11
  • 12
  • 13
  • 14
  • 15
  • 16
  • 17
  • 18
  • 19
  • 20
  • 21
  • 22
  • 23
  • 24
  • 25
  • 26
  • 27
  • 28
  • 29
  • 30
May 2025
  • Mon
  • Tue
  • Wed
  • Thu
  • Fri
  • Sat
  • Sun
  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 7
  • 8
  • 9
  • 10
  • 11
  • 12
  • 13
  • 14
  • 15
  • 16
  • 17
  • 18
  • 19
  • 20
  • 21
  • 22
  • 23
  • 24
  • 25
  • 26
  • 27
  • 28
  • 29
  • 30
  • 31
Swipe up to view more
Filter by:
Hotel Star Rating
≤2345
Popular Filters
Amazing 4.5+Great 4.0+Good 3.5+Pleasant 3.0+

We found these top-rated hotels near Bahrain for you

Choose your travel dates to see the latest prices and deals.
Most Booked
Lowest Price
Closest to Downtown
Highest Rated
See All Hotels Near Bahrain

FAQs About Hotels in Bahrain

How much does it cost to stay in a hotel in Bahrain?

The average price for hotels in Bahrain is AU$ 75 for weekdays, and AU$ 75 for weekends (Friday–Saturday).

What are the best hotels in Bahrain?

From business trips to holiday stays, Bahrain offers a wide selection of popular hotels to suit every need. Zahoor Hotel and Restaurant, Dream Valley Guest House and Madina Tower Hotel & Restaurant are excellent options for your stay.

Which hotels in Bahrain have the best breakfast?

Madina Tower Hotel & Restaurant and Zahoor Hotel and Restaurant provide a tasty breakfast to help you get going.

Bahrain Hotel Info

Highest PriceAU$ 115
Lowest PriceAU$ 74
Number of Reviews0
Total Properties0
Average Price (Weekdays)AU$ 75
Average Price (Weekends)AU$ 75